Life's Beautiful Days by Nilakshi Borgohain, is a story of a nameless soul, in her timeless journey of hope.
Abandoned and surviving on scraps, her life changes when a corporate social initiative grants her an education. From those fragile beginnings, she embarks on a courageous journey of identity, belonging, and meaning.
Success brings its own trials: moral dilemmas, inner conflicts, and a relentless search for self. More than a story of survival, this novel celebrates resilience, mentorship, and the human spirit.
Lyrical and thought-provoking, it asks what true fulfilment really means.
